Output 16f96ead356b8d3426411089ec1e67b4f64e44274b1eef9b3c36df9a58d37dac:1

value
4407200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66942639620742d36d30b8baa52f3f67800661a8 OP_EQUAL
address
3B3QKhrWY2sE3eHJLtimzU1CjiRWwZCSVV
transaction
16f96ead356b8d3426411089ec1e67b4f64e44274b1eef9b3c36df9a58d37dac
spent
true